import * as chai from "chai";
import { expect } from "chai";
import chaiAsPromised from "chai-as-promised";
import sinon, { createSandbox } from "sinon";
import sinonChai from "sinon-chai";
import { getAriStub, getCreateVoiceClient } from "./helper";
import { createRecordHandler } from "../../src/voice/handlers/createRecordHandler";
import { AriEvent } from "../../src/voice/types";
chai.use(chaiAsPromised);
chai.use(sinonChai);
const sandbox = createSandbox();
describe("@voice/handler/Record", function () {
afterEach(function () {
return sandbox.restore();
});
it("should handle the Record command", async function () {
// Arrange
const ari = getAriStub(sandbox);
const recordingName = "recordingName";
const sessionRef = "sessionRef";
// eslint-disable-next-line @typescript-eslint/no-var-requires
const nanoid = require("nanoid");
sandbox.stub(nanoid, "nanoid").returns(recordingName);
const onStub = ari.on as sinon.SinonStub;
onStub.withArgs(AriEvent.RECORDING_FINISHED).callsFake((_, cb) => {
cb({ recording: { name: recordingName } });
});
const createVoiceClient = getCreateVoiceClient(sandbox);
const recordRequest = {
beep: true,
finishOnKey: "#",
maxDuration: 10,
maxSilence: 5,
sessionRef
};
// Act
await createRecordHandler(ari, createVoiceClient())(recordRequest);
// Assert
expect(ari.channels.record).to.have.been.calledOnce;
});
it("should handle the Record command with a failed recording", async function () {
// Arrange
const ari = getAriStub(sandbox);
const recordingName = "recordingName";
const sessionRef = "sessionRef";
// eslint-disable-next-line @typescript-eslint/no-var-requires
const nanoid = require("nanoid");
sandbox.stub(nanoid, "nanoid").returns(recordingName);
const onStub = ari.on as sinon.SinonStub;
onStub.withArgs(AriEvent.RECORDING_FAILED).callsFake((_, cb) => {
cb({ recording: { name: recordingName, cause: "cause" } });
});
const createVoiceClient = getCreateVoiceClient(sandbox);
const recordRequest = {
beep: true,
finishOnKey: "#",
maxDuration: 10,
maxSilence: 5,
sessionRef
};
// Act
const promise = createRecordHandler(ari, createVoiceClient())(recordRequest);
// Assert
await expect(promise).to.eventually.be.rejectedWith("Recording failed");
});
});
